With the massacre of 50 people in New Zealand streamed live March 15, Facebook faced two problems: The immediacy of Facebook Live, and the fact that videos of any sort – including playbacks of live ones – can quickly explode globally.
It might be time to force social media providers to delay live broadcasting or streaming, Tom Bossert, former homeland security adviser for US President Donald Trump, said on ABC’s This Week on March 17.
